Output 5fa561ec82fbfd3b674112f3e957a426d6dded361571589086cae8253b1e50d4:18

value
1280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40e7e34e87980923405bd789ed93361548db93ae OP_EQUAL
address
37cCxg9m9LKM6JdTDLXrJfbcN79UbD5yja
transaction
5fa561ec82fbfd3b674112f3e957a426d6dded361571589086cae8253b1e50d4
confirmations
367096
spent
true